AGT-181 is a fusion protein containing alpha-L-Iduronidase that is intended to deliver the enzyme peripherally and to the brain, when administered intravenously. This study is a safety and dose ranging study to obtain safety and exposure data, as well as information on the biological activity of the investigational drug.

| Label | Type | Description | Intervention Names |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cohort 1 | Experimental | 1 mg/kg AGT-181 (fusion protein of anti-human insulin receptor monoclonal antibody and alpha-L-iduronidase; HIRMAb-IDUA) administered once weekly x 8 weeks |
|
| Cohort 2 | Experimental | 3 mg/kg AGT-181 (HIRMAb-IDUA) administered once weekly x 8 weeks |
|
| Cohort 3 | Experimental | 6-9 mg/kg AGT-181 (HIRMAb-IDUA) administered once weekly x 8 weeks |
|
